Stuttering in menus
This one's a bit weird. The game runs fine for me and things seem smooth enough in game.

But the in-game menus (ESC and everything after that) all have this weird stutter. It's as if the menu animations don't play at a constant speed.

Anyone else experienced something like this? It's not a big deal, so I can probably ignore it, but it'd be nice to have that working too.

Teo_ Feb 24 @ 11:01am 
I'm having the exact same issue. The game runs perfectly fine and smooth but as soon as I hit the ESC key and the menu appears it begins to stutter like crazy. The lag and delay are all over the place when I try to navigate the menu. I opened the MSI afterburner as well and the frametime is all over the place. I also noticed that if I open the map through the menu it also lags but when I hit the M shortcut it works fine. I tried running at different refresh rates and fullscreen/windowed modes but it won't go away. Installed on NVME M2 drive.
Last edited by Teo_; Feb 24 @ 11:04am
I fixed mine by enabling NVIDIA ReBAR. Check yours. When I got the ReBAR running, it fixed that kind of lagging in menu. RDR2 is one of the listed games that improves with ReBAR.

Ryzen 7 5700x3d, RTX 3070, 32gb, 1tb nvme.
